Understanding Bot Lobbies in Delta Force

What Are Bot Lobbies?

Bot lobbies are matches populated primarily with AI-controlled opponents rather than human players. They serve multiple purposes: new player protection, skill development, and maintaining queue times during low-population periods. The matchmaking system dynamically adjusts bot distribution based on server population, player skill levels, and account status.

AI opponents exhibit programmed behavior patterns designed to simulate human players while providing less challenging environments for weapon progression. How Matchmaking Works

Delta Force employs a sophisticated algorithm evaluating multiple factors: account level, recent performance metrics, and current player population across available servers. When the system detects low player counts—particularly during off-peak hours—it fills empty slots with AI opponents to ensure matches start promptly.

Matches require minimum 24 out of 64 players to begin with predominantly human participants. Below this threshold, the system automatically increases bot population. Some players encounter matches with 60+ AI bots when queuing at unconventional times.

MMR and Bot Distribution

Matchmaking Rating (MMR) significantly influences bot lobby likelihood. New accounts and players with lower MMR receive preferential placement in newbie protection matches featuring substantially higher bot populations.

The newbie protection system targets players within their first 70+ hours of gameplay, creating a graduated difficulty curve. During this period, matches may contain 90% bots and only 10% human players—ideal for weapon mastery and familiarization.

As your MMR increases through consistent performance and accumulated playtime, the system progressively reduces bot frequency and matches you against more skilled human opponents.

How to Get Bot Lobbies Without VPN

Method 1: Optimal Time Windows

Accessing bot lobbies consistently requires strategic timing based on regional server population patterns. The most reliable window for AI-heavy matches occurs during off-peak hours when human player counts drop below matchmaking thresholds.

Queuing at 03:00 local server time produces the highest bot lobby probability due to minimal active player populations. Early morning hours between 02:00-06:00 consistently yield matches with 25 bots in Warfare modes alongside only 5-10 human players.

To maximize bot lobby access:

  1. Identify your regional server's lowest activity period (typically 02:00-05:00)

  2. Queue for matches during these windows consistently

  3. Monitor lobby composition during matchmaking countdown

  4. Exit and re-queue if player count exceeds 15-20 participants

  5. Maintain this schedule for predictable bot match access

Method 2: Game Mode Selection

Game mode selection dramatically impacts bot lobby probability. Following the November 28, 2024 update, bots were removed from multiplayer Warfare modes, fundamentally changing bot lobby accessibility.

Training mode remains entirely PvE-focused, offering unlimited bot access for weapon familiarization and attachment testing. Players have successfully ground 2000 clips in training mode for weapon mastery progression without encountering human opponents.

Operations mode includes NPCs alongside human players, creating hybrid matches ideal for weapon leveling while maintaining some competitive elements. The Heartbeach map in Operations mode, available since December 12, 2024, features consistent AI presence suitable for progression farming.

Hazard Operations Raid submode provides pure PvE experiences with no gear loss, making it optimal for risk-free weapon leveling. Raids mode, launching before the Black Hawk Down campaign in January 2025, offers structured AI encounters designed specifically for practice and progression.

Method 3: Account Level Management

New accounts automatically enter protection lobbies versus bots, providing immediate access to AI-heavy matches. The newbie protection system activates from account creation and persists through approximately 70+ hours of gameplay.

Creating a fresh account guarantees bot lobby access without additional manipulation. However, this requires rebuilding progression from zero, making it suitable only for players specifically focused on weapon leveling rather than overall account advancement.

For existing accounts, MMR management involves maintaining performance metrics that keep you within lower skill brackets:

  • Prioritize weapon variety over meta loadout dominance

  • Focus on objective completion rather than elimination counts

  • Avoid extended winning streaks that rapidly increase MMR

  • Accept natural skill bracket placement without artificial manipulation

  • Understand that MMR adjusts gradually over multiple matches

Method 4: Regional Server Considerations

Regional server selection influences bot lobby frequency based on local player population density. Servers with lower active player counts naturally feature higher bot populations to maintain match availability.

When 0/64 player servers exist, the matchmaking system fills these entirely with bots for players who queue during extreme off-peak periods. This creates guaranteed bot lobbies but requires precise timing and willingness to accept potentially higher latency if selecting non-primary regional servers.

Extended queue times (exceeding 2-3 minutes) typically signal low player availability, increasing bot lobby probability when matches finally form.

Method 5: Solo Queue vs Squad

Solo queuing significantly increases bot lobby probability compared to squad-based matchmaking. The algorithm prioritizes matching grouped players against other squads, which requires sufficient human player pools and consequently reduces bot frequency.

Solo players enter a broader matchmaking pool where the system more readily fills empty slots with AI opponents when human players are unavailable. Squad matchmaking attempts to maintain competitive balance by matching team compositions, requiring larger player populations.

For maximum bot lobby access, consistently queue solo during identified off-peak windows while selecting modes with confirmed AI presence.

Identifying AI Matches

AI Movement Patterns

AI opponents exhibit distinct movement patterns that experienced players quickly recognize. Bots follow predetermined patrol routes with predictable timing, often repeating identical paths across multiple matches on the same map. They demonstrate limited tactical adaptation, failing to adjust strategies based on player behavior.

Combat engagement patterns reveal AI limitations clearly. Bots typically engage at medium range with consistent accuracy that doesn't fluctuate based on weapon type or situational pressure. They lack the erratic movement, cover usage variability, and tactical repositioning that characterize human players.

AI opponents demonstrate poor situational awareness regarding flanking maneuvers and multi-angle threats. They focus on immediate line-of-sight targets while ignoring peripheral threats.

Nameplate Indicators

Player nameplates and profile characteristics provide immediate bot identification clues. AI opponents typically feature generic naming conventions with random alphanumeric combinations or basic word patterns lacking the creativity of human-chosen gamertags.

Profile inspection reveals additional indicators. Bot accounts show minimal customization, default avatars, and absence of progression statistics. They lack clan tags, custom emblems, and the cosmetic personalization that engaged human players typically display.

Lobby composition analysis before match start offers prediction opportunities. When the player list populates instantly to maximum capacity without gradual filling, you're likely entering a bot-heavy match.

Combat Response Differences

AI reaction times follow programmed parameters that differ noticeably from human response patterns. Bots exhibit unnaturally consistent reaction speeds—neither exceptionally fast nor realistically variable—creating a mechanical feel to engagements.

When surprised or flanked, AI opponents demonstrate predetermined response sequences rather than the panic reactions, overcorrections, and adaptive responses typical of human players. They execute perfect 180-degree turns at consistent speeds without the mouse movement acceleration and deceleration patterns inherent to human input.

Damage response behaviors further distinguish AI from human players. Bots continue executing programmed actions even while taking damage, lacking the immediate cover-seeking and evasive maneuvers that human survival instinct triggers.

Weapon Leveling Efficiency

XP Rates: Bots vs Players

Weapon XP rates in bot lobbies match those of human-populated matches on a per-elimination basis, making AI matches equally efficient for raw weapon leveling when kill volume remains consistent. The critical advantage lies in elimination frequency—bot matches enable significantly higher kill counts per minute due to predictable AI behavior.

Players can realistically achieve 40-60 eliminations per bot match compared to 15-25 in competitive human lobbies, effectively doubling or tripling weapon XP acquisition rates. This efficiency multiplier compounds over extended farming sessions.

However, challenge completion requirements that specify player eliminations or competitive match participation may not progress in bot lobbies, depending on specific challenge parameters.

Optimal Kill Volume Strategies

Maximizing kill volume in bot lobbies requires strategic positioning and weapon selection optimized for AI behavior patterns. Bots congregate around objective points with predictable timing, creating target-rich environments.

High-capacity, fast-firing weapons maximize elimination efficiency against grouped AI opponents. Light machine guns and assault rifles with extended magazines enable sustained fire without reload interruptions.

Effective kill volume optimization:

  1. Identify high-traffic AI patrol intersections on each map

  2. Position near objective points where bots naturally congregate

  3. Use weapons with 50+ round capacities to minimize reload downtime

  4. Prioritize target acquisition speed over precision aiming

  5. Rotate positions when AI patrol patterns shift

  6. Maintain aggressive positioning rather than defensive camping

  7. Focus on volume over efficiency—every elimination counts equally

Weapon Mastery Challenges

Weapon mastery challenges progress efficiently in bot lobbies for elimination-based requirements. Challenges requiring specific attachment configurations, damage types, or elimination methods complete naturally through high-volume bot farming.

Headshot challenges benefit particularly from predictable AI movement patterns. Bots maintain consistent head positioning and movement speeds, enabling players to develop muscle memory for headshot placement.

Multi-elimination challenges (double kills, triple kills, etc.) complete rapidly due to AI clustering behaviors. Bots group around objectives without the spacing discipline human players maintain, creating frequent opportunities for multi-target eliminations.

Time Investment Returns

Bot lobby farming delivers optimal returns for players with limited playtime seeking maximum weapon progression efficiency. A focused 2-hour bot lobby session can complete weapon mastery tracks that would require 8-10 hours in competitive mixed lobbies, representing a 4-5x efficiency multiplier.

The progression curve favors bot lobbies most heavily during early weapon levels when attachment unlocks provide the greatest gameplay impact. Accelerating through initial weapon tiers enables faster access to competitive-viable configurations.

Diminishing returns emerge for players seeking skill development alongside progression. Bot lobbies provide no competitive experience, tactical learning, or skill refinement—they purely optimize numerical progression.

Best Game Modes for Bot Farming

Training Mode

Training mode offers unlimited bot access with zero competitive pressure, making it the most reliable environment for pure weapon leveling. Players can enter training mode at any time regardless of server population, eliminating queue time variability.

The mode supports unrestricted weapon testing and attachment configuration experimentation without match time limits or performance pressure. This enables methodical weapon mastery progression through sustained farming sessions.

Training mode's primary limitation involves potential XP rate caps or progression restrictions compared to live matches. While elimination counts progress weapon levels, the absence of match completion bonuses and objective XP may reduce overall progression speed.

Operations Mode

Operations mode maintains consistent NPC presence alongside human players, creating hybrid environments that balance progression efficiency with competitive elements. The mode's AI distribution varies based on server population but typically includes 30-40% bot composition even during moderate activity periods.

The Heartbeach map specifically features reliable AI spawns integrated into the operational flow, providing consistent elimination opportunities without requiring pure bot lobby access.

Operations matches reward objective completion alongside eliminations, enabling dual progression through weapon XP and match performance bonuses. Players can optimize farming by focusing on AI-heavy objective points while contributing to team success.

Hazard Operations Raid

Hazard Operations Raid submode provides pure PvE experiences specifically designed for practice and progression without competitive pressure or gear loss risk. This mode launches before the Black Hawk Down campaign in January 2025.

Raid mode's no-gear-loss design eliminates progression risk, enabling aggressive playstyles and weapon experimentation without fear of setbacks. Players can test unconventional loadouts and high-risk tactics while maintaining consistent progression.

The structured encounter design in Raids creates predictable AI spawns and engagement patterns, enabling optimized farming routes that maximize elimination frequency.

Timing and Matchmaking Optimization

Peak Hours vs Off-Peak

Server population directly correlates with bot lobby frequency. Peak hours (18:00-23:00 local time) feature maximum human player populations, reducing bot lobby probability to near-zero in most modes.

Off-peak periods (02:00-08:00 local time) produce inverse conditions where insufficient human players force the matchmaking system to fill lobbies with AI opponents. During these windows, bot lobby probability exceeds 80% in modes that support AI opponents.

The transition periods between peak and off-peak (08:00-10:00 and 23:00-02:00) feature variable bot distributions as player populations gradually shift.

Regional Time Zone Considerations

Regional server selection enables access to different time zones' off-peak periods without VPN services. Players can queue for servers in regions currently experiencing low-activity hours while maintaining acceptable latency.

Asian servers typically experience off-peak conditions during European and American peak hours, creating bot lobby opportunities for Western players willing to accept moderate latency increases. Similarly, European servers offer off-peak access during Asian peak periods.

Latency tolerance determines viable regional server options. Players with stable connections can typically accept 100-150ms latency for bot farming purposes, as AI opponents don't exploit latency disadvantages like human players.

Weekday vs Weekend Patterns

Weekend player populations remain elevated during traditional off-peak hours, reducing bot lobby frequency compared to weekday patterns. Saturday and Sunday mornings (08:00-12:00) feature higher human player counts than equivalent weekday windows.

Weekday early mornings (Monday-Friday 03:00-07:00) provide the most consistent bot lobby access due to minimal player populations across all regions.

Holiday periods and special events disrupt normal patterns by increasing player populations across all time windows. During major updates, seasonal events, or holiday weekends, bot lobby access decreases significantly.

Queue Time Indicators

Extended queue times reliably predict bot lobby placement. When matchmaking exceeds 90-120 seconds without finding a match, the system typically relaxes player requirements and fills available slots with AI opponents.

Immediate match formation (under 15 seconds) during off-peak periods almost guarantees bot lobby placement, as the system has pre-populated lobbies with AI opponents awaiting human players. These instant matches feature the highest bot percentages, often exceeding 80-90% AI composition.

Players can exploit queue time indicators by monitoring matchmaking duration and canceling queues that find matches too quickly during peak hours while accepting extended queues during off-peak periods.

Common Misconceptions

Why VPN Isn't Required

VPN services provide no matchmaking advantage for accessing bot lobbies in Delta Force. The matchmaking system determines bot distribution based on server population, account status, and timing—factors entirely independent of connection routing or IP geolocation that VPN services modify.

The misconception stems from other games where regional matchmaking pools vary significantly in player density. Delta Force's global server architecture and dynamic bot filling eliminate this advantage, making VPN services unnecessary and potentially detrimental due to increased latency.

Players reporting VPN success for bot lobby access likely benefited from coincidental timing (queuing during target region's off-peak hours) rather than the VPN itself.

The Account Reset Myth

Creating new accounts guarantees newbie protection lobby access but doesn't provide sustainable long-term bot lobby farming. The protection system expires after 70+ hours of gameplay, after which the account enters standard matchmaking pools.

Account reset strategies that involve repeatedly creating fresh accounts face diminishing returns due to progression loss and the time investment required to unlock desired weapons on each new account.

Maintaining a single account while optimizing timing and mode selection provides superior long-term bot lobby access compared to account cycling.

SBMM Misunderstandings

Delta Force implements skill-based matchmaking (SBMM) but not in the rigid, performance-punishing manner many players assume. The system prioritizes match quality and queue time balance over strict skill segregation.

Players don't need to intentionally underperform or manipulate statistics to access bot lobbies. The system introduces bots based on player availability rather than individual skill assessment, meaning even high-skill players encounter bot lobbies during off-peak periods.

SBMM primarily affects human-versus-human match composition rather than bot lobby access.

Ban Risk Clarity

Accessing bot lobbies through legitimate matchmaking mechanics carries zero ban risk. The game intentionally includes bot opponents as designed system features rather than exploits or unintended behaviors.

The Terms of Service prohibit matchmaking manipulation through external tools, account sharing, or deliberate match abandonment—none of which are required for bot lobby access. Simply queuing during off-peak periods or selecting specific game modes represents normal player behavior.

Third-party tools, matchmaking exploits, or coordinated queue manipulation to guarantee bot lobbies would violate ToS and risk account action.

Advanced Weapon Leveling Strategies

Loadout Optimization for Maximum XP

Weapon selection significantly impacts leveling efficiency in bot lobbies. High-capacity automatic weapons maximize elimination frequency by reducing reload downtime and enabling sustained fire against grouped AI opponents.

Attachment configurations should prioritize handling speed and target acquisition over precision accuracy. Bot opponents don't require the accuracy optimizations necessary against human players.

Optimal bot farming loadout principles:

  • Primary weapon: High-capacity LMG or extended-mag assault rifle

  • Attachments: ADS speed, sprint-to-fire, movement speed priorities

  • Secondary: High-capacity pistol for emergency situations

  • Equipment: Offensive grenades for grouped AI opponents

  • Perks: Reload speed, ammunition capacity, movement enhancements

  • Avoid: Long-range optics, precision barrels, stability attachments

Multi-Weapon Leveling

Efficient progression requires strategic weapon rotation to maintain engagement while avoiding burnout from repetitive gameplay. Rotating between weapon classes every 2-3 matches prevents fatigue while ensuring balanced progression across your arsenal.

Challenge-based rotation optimizes progression by focusing on weapons with active daily or weekly challenges. Completing challenges while leveling weapons provides dual progression benefits.

Implement systematic rotation schedules:

  1. Primary weapon to first attachment milestone (Level 10-15)

  2. Switch to secondary weapon class for variety

  3. Return to primary for next milestone (Level 20-25)

  4. Rotate to third weapon class

  5. Complete primary weapon mastery

  6. Repeat cycle with new primary weapon

Daily Challenge Integration

Daily challenges often align with weapon leveling objectives, creating synergy opportunities that accelerate overall progression. Prioritize weapons featured in active challenges to complete both weapon mastery and challenge objectives simultaneously.

Challenge requirements frequently specify elimination counts, damage thresholds, or specific attachment usage—all naturally achievable through bot lobby farming.

Weekly challenge rotations provide planning opportunities. Review upcoming challenges to identify featured weapon classes, then prioritize leveling those weapons during the challenge period.

Battle Pass Synergy

Battle Pass ownership provides XP multipliers and progression bonuses that compound bot lobby farming efficiency. Premium tier bonuses typically include 10-25% XP boosts that apply to weapon leveling.

Battle Pass tier rewards often include weapon XP tokens, double XP periods, and progression accelerators that stack with bot lobby farming. Strategic token usage during extended farming sessions maximizes their value, potentially doubling already-efficient bot lobby progression rates.

Free Battle Pass tiers provide some progression benefits, but premium tier investment delivers substantially better returns for players committed to rapid weapon leveling.

Long-Term Progression

Transitioning to Competitive Play

Bot lobby farming develops weapon familiarity and unlocks attachments but doesn't build competitive skills necessary for human-populated matches. Successful transition requires deliberate practice against human opponents to develop tactical awareness, positioning discipline, and adaptive combat strategies.

Gradual integration works better than abrupt transitions. Alternate between bot farming sessions and competitive matches to maintain weapon progression while developing real combat skills.

Competitive performance initially suffers when transitioning from bot lobbies due to the dramatic difficulty increase. Accept this adjustment period as necessary skill development rather than regression.

Maintaining Weapon Proficiency

Weapon mastery completion doesn't guarantee sustained proficiency. Regular use against human opponents maintains muscle memory and tactical understanding that bot farming doesn't develop. Dedicate at least 30-40% of playtime to competitive matches.

Weapon meta shifts require periodic proficiency updates even for mastered weapons. Balance changes, new attachment releases, and evolving competitive strategies necessitate ongoing adaptation that bot lobbies can't provide.

Cross-weapon proficiency prevents over-specialization. While bot farming enables rapid mastery of specific weapons, competitive viability requires adaptability across weapon classes.

Meta Weapon Priority

Prioritize meta-relevant weapons for bot lobby farming to ensure progression time investment translates to competitive advantage. Current meta weapons provide immediate competitive viability upon mastery completion.

Meta priorities shift with balance patches and seasonal updates. Following the December 5, 2024 open beta and subsequent Operation Serpentine launch on January 1, 2025, weapon balance will likely evolve significantly.

Recommended meta weapon progression order:

  1. Current top-tier assault rifle (versatile, always competitive)

  2. Meta SMG for close-quarters dominance

  3. Competitive marksman rifle for range flexibility

  4. High-capacity LMG for objective control

  5. Meta shotgun for specific map applications

  6. Specialized weapons based on personal playstyle

Sustainable Progression

Long-term account development requires balancing efficient progression with sustainable engagement that prevents burnout. Pure bot farming creates monotonous gameplay that diminishes enjoyment despite progression efficiency.

Set realistic progression goals based on available playtime rather than attempting to master every weapon immediately. Focused progression on 2-3 weapons per week provides achievable targets while maintaining engagement.

Sustainable strategies recognize that progression serves competitive performance rather than existing as an end goal. Prioritize weapons you genuinely enjoy using and that fit your natural playstyle over meta weapons that feel uncomfortable.

Frequently Asked Questions

How do bot lobbies work in Delta Force Hawk Ops?

Bot lobbies occur when the matchmaking system fills empty player slots with AI opponents due to insufficient human players in your skill bracket and regional server. The system automatically introduces bots when player counts fall below the 24/64 minimum threshold, particularly during off-peak hours between 02:00-06:00 local server time. New accounts receive newbie protection lobbies with 90% bots for approximately 70+ hours of gameplay.

What time of day has the most bot lobbies in Delta Force?

Early morning hours between 02:00-06:00 local server time produce the highest bot lobby frequency, with 03:00 representing the optimal window. During these periods, matches consistently feature 25+ bots with only 5-10 human players due to minimal active player populations. Weekday mornings provide more reliable bot access than weekends.

How do I know if I'm in a bot lobby in Delta Force?

Bot lobbies exhibit several identifiable characteristics: instant lobby filling to 64 players, generic alphanumeric player names, predictable AI movement patterns along fixed patrol routes, mechanical reaction times without human variability, and poor tactical adaptation to flanking or multi-angle threats. AI opponents also demonstrate consistent medium-range accuracy without the performance fluctuation typical of human players.

Do bot lobbies give less XP in Delta Force?

Bot lobbies provide identical XP per elimination as human-populated matches, making them equally efficient for weapon leveling on a per-kill basis. The actual efficiency advantage comes from dramatically higher elimination frequencies—40-60 kills per bot match versus 15-25 in competitive lobbies—effectively doubling or tripling weapon XP acquisition rates through volume rather than multipliers.

What game mode has the most bots in Delta Force?

Training mode offers guaranteed 100% bot availability at all times. Following the November 28, 2024 update that removed bots from Warfare modes, Operations mode and Hazard Operations Raid submode provide the most consistent AI presence in live matches, typically featuring 30-40% bot composition even during moderate activity periods. Raid mode specifically offers pure PvE experiences with no gear loss.

Can you get banned for using bot lobbies in Delta Force?

No ban risk exists for accessing bot lobbies through legitimate matchmaking mechanics like timing optimization, mode selection, and server choice. Bot opponents are intentional system features designed to maintain match availability during low-population periods. Only third-party tools, matchmaking exploits, or coordinated queue manipulation violate Terms of Service—individual strategic queuing represents normal player behavior fully supported by game design.
